Добавить в корзинуПозвонить
Найти в Дзене
ИноВатсон

«Agile в 2025: Адаптация к новым вызовам с AI и автоматизацией»

Привет, меня зовут Сергей Мазур, и это ежедневный обзор использования нейросетей для улучшения бизнеса от сервиса Иноватсон — платформы поддержки отдела продаж на основе контроля качества звонков. Давайте поговорим о том, как Agile-методология будет эволюционировать в 2025 году и какие практики помогут командам создавать более качественное программное обеспечение быстрее и эффективнее. В 2025 году Agile продолжит быть основой современных практик разработки. Его адаптивность и акцент на поэтапном прогрессе стали непременными условиями для успешной работы команд. Однако, чтобы оставаться конкурентоспособными, важно не только следовать традициям, но и внедрять новые подходы. Автоматизация в разработке программного обеспечения становится необходимостью. В 2025 году современные инструменты автоматизации будут играть ключевую роль в оптимизации процессов. Например, автоматизированное тестирование значительно сокращает время на регрессионное тестирование, исключая вероятность ошибок при внедр
Оглавление

Будущее Agile: Как адаптироваться к новым вызовам в 2025 году

Привет, меня зовут Сергей Мазур, и это ежедневный обзор использования нейросетей для улучшения бизнеса от сервиса Иноватсон — платформы поддержки отдела продаж на основе контроля качества звонков. Давайте поговорим о том, как Agile-методология будет эволюционировать в 2025 году и какие практики помогут командам создавать более качественное программное обеспечение быстрее и эффективнее.

Почему Agile остается на переднем крае разработки программного обеспечения?

В 2025 году Agile продолжит быть основой современных практик разработки. Его адаптивность и акцент на поэтапном прогрессе стали непременными условиями для успешной работы команд. Однако, чтобы оставаться конкурентоспособными, важно не только следовать традициям, но и внедрять новые подходы.

Автоматизация: необходимость, а не роскошь

Автоматизация в разработке программного обеспечения становится необходимостью. В 2025 году современные инструменты автоматизации будут играть ключевую роль в оптимизации процессов. Например, автоматизированное тестирование значительно сокращает время на регрессионное тестирование, исключая вероятность ошибок при внедрении новых изменений. Инструменты, такие как Selenium, Cypress и TestCafe, продолжают развиваться, предлагая более мощные функции для сложных сценариев тестирования 💻.

CI/CD: ускоряем процесс с помощью интеграции

Непрерывная интеграция и непрерывная доставка (CI/CD) стали стандартом в разработке. Эти практики автоматизируют процесс интеграции изменений кода и развертывания их в различных окружениях, что минимизирует ошибки и ускоряет доставку продукта. Интеграция инструментов, таких как Jenkins, GitLab CI и CircleCI, позволяет командам уверенно разрабатывать, тестировать и развертывать программное обеспечение с минимальными помехами 🚀.

Искусственный интеллект и машинное обучение: новые горизонты Agile

AИ и МL готовы изменить правила игры в Agile-практиках к 2025 году. Инструменты, основанные на AI, могут предсказывать возможные узкие места и предлагать оптимизации. Алгоритмы машинного обучения анализируют исторические данные, предоставляя ценную информацию о рисках проектов и производительности команды, что позволяет более точно планировать спринты и распределять ресурсы. К примеру, такие инструменты, как CodeGuru и DeepCode, используют AI для выявления проблем качества кода и предоставляют рекомендации по улучшению. Ожидается, что с развитием AI мы увидим еще более сложные решения, интегрированные в Agile-рамки, которые будут предоставлять обратную связь в реальном времени и повышать общую эффективность 💡.

Адаптация к удаленной работе: новые инструменты для сотрудничества

Переход к удаленной и распределенной работе стал актуальнее, чем когда-либо. В 2025 году Agile-команды должны адаптироваться к этой новой реальности, улучшая инструменты для сотрудничества и коммуникации. Платформы для виртуального взаимодействия, такие как Microsoft Teams, Slack и Zoom, становятся необходимыми для поддержания связи между участниками команды.

Кроме того, такие инструменты, как Miro и Figma, позволяют проводить совместные сессии дизайна и мозгового штурма в реальном времени, что помогает преодолеть разрыв между удаленными и офисными сотрудниками. Эти платформы способствуют поддержанию единого рабочего потока, обеспечивая возможность для каждого члена команды эффективно участвовать в процессе, независимо от их местоположения 🌍.

Улучшение прозрачности и коммуникации

Эффективная коммуникация — это неотъемлемая часть Agile-практик. В 2025 году внимание будет сосредоточено на усилении прозрачности через инструменты, предлагающие обновления в реальном времени и видимость хода проекта. Agile-проектные управления, такие как Jira, Trello и Asana, предоставляют информационные панели и функции отчетности, которые информируют всех заинтересованных лиц о статусе задач и спринтов. Регулярные стендап-встречи, обзоры спринтов и ретроспективы останутся важными для обеспечения согласованности команды и оперативного решения возникающих проблем.

Культура непрерывного улучшения: инвестиции в будущее

Agile-разработка — это не только о процессах и инструментах, но и о создании культуры непрерывного улучшения. В 2025 году Agile-команды будут все больше сосредотачиваться на создании среды, которая поощряет постоянное обучение и адаптацию. Это включает инвестиции в профессиональное развитие, такие как мастер-классы, конференции и онлайн-курсы, чтобы поддерживать навыки и знания на актуальном уровне.

Поощрение участников команды экспериментировать с новыми технологиями и методологиями может привести к инновационным решениям и улучшениям. Ретроспективы Agile будут играть решающую роль в выявлении областей для улучшения и внедрении практических изменений, повышающих производительность команды и качество продукта.

Данные как основа принятия решений

К 2025 году принятие решений на основе данных станет еще более важным в Agile-практиках. Использование метрик и аналитики предоставит ценную информацию о производительности команды, прогрессе проекта и качестве программного обеспечения. Ключевые показатели эффективности (KPI), такие как время выполнения, время цикла и уровень дефектов, помогут командам оценивать свою эффективность и выявлять области для улучшения.

Инструменты, такие как Power BI и Tableau, могут быть интегрированы с Agile-проектным управлением для создания всесторонних информационных панелей и отчетов. Анализируя эти метрики, команды смогут принимать обоснованные решения, оптимизировать свои процессы и непрерывно улучшать свои практики 📊.

Облачные технологии: новые возможности для Agile

Облачные вычисления произвели революцию в подходах к разработке и развертыванию программного обеспечения. В 2025 году Agile-команды все чаще будут использовать облачные архитектуры для достижения масштабируемости, гибкости и экономической эффективности. Технологии, такие как контейнеризация (используя Docker или Kubernetes) и серверless-вычисления (используя AWS Lambda или Azure Functions), позволят командам более эффективно разрабатывать и развертывать приложения.

Облачные практики также поддерживают принципиальные установки Agile, способствуя быстрым циклам разработки и развертывания. Используя облачную инфраструктуру, команды смогут быстро масштабировать свои приложения, тестировать новые функции и реагировать на изменения требований с большей гибкостью.

DevOps и GitOps: синергия с Agile

DevOps и GitOps набирают популярность как дополнительные практики для Agile-разработки. DevOps акцентирует внимание на сотрудничестве между командами разработки и эксплуатации, автоматизируя процесс развертывания и улучшая общую эффективность. GitOps расширяет эту концепцию, используя репозитории Git как источник правды для управления инфраструктурой и развертываниями.

В 2025 году интеграция практик DevOps и GitOps в Agile-рабочие процессы поможет командам достичь более быстрого и надежного развертывания программного обеспечения. Автоматизация управления инфраструктурой и процессами развертывания позволит командам сосредоточиться на доставке ценности клиентам и более эффективно реагировать на изменения 🔄.

Итоги: Agile в 2025 году

По мере приближения к 2025 году практики Agile-разработки будут продолжать развиваться, под влиянием технологических достижений и изменений в рабочей среде. Принятие современных методов автоматизации, улучшение сотрудничества, акцент на непрерывном улучшении и адаптация к новым технологиям являются ключевыми факторами для успешного существования в этой динамичной среде.

Реализуя эти лучшие практики Agile, команды смогут создавать более качественное программное обеспечение более эффективно, поддерживать конкурентные преимущества и предоставлять исключительную ценность своим клиентам. Будущее Agile-разработки многообещающее, и с правильными инструментами и практиками команды смогут успешно справляться с вызовами и возможностями, которые ждут впереди.

Хотите увеличить прибыль с помощью ИИ? Переходите на наш сайт: /